The Impact You Will Make

Work in a team of cyber threat analysts, economists, data scientists, actuaries and risk modelers to develop insights, scores, and features for a suite of products delivering cyber risk analytics to the (re)insurance industry

Own CyberCube's point of view on technology risk including factors such as:

Offensive capabilities and trends among threat actor classes, and validating CyberCube models against observed real-world events,

Security hygiene standards (e.g. NIST CSF, CIS) and mitigations for companies to lower their potential likelihood and/or impact of events, and

Technology adoption and trends including the adoption, reliance on and governance of artificial intelligence

… translating these factors into the assumptions and scenarios that drive risk models – especially where historical data is limited

Own the scenario and "event family" library for cyber catastrophe modeling, including emerging AI-driven scenarios

Own the assumptions register and expert-judgment governance: the documented, client-defensible rationale for modeling choices that are not purely data-driven

Present CyberCube methodology, threat landscape and emerging risk trends to clients and prospects and engage in strategic dialogue with key stakeholders as one of CyberCube's key voices and thought leaders on technology risk. Be able to differentiate when speaking with varying technical backgrounds and seniority (e.g. analyst to C-Suite)

Engage in cross functional collaboration with stakeholders from engineering, product management, analytics personnel, and client facing teams to deliver on projects and product goals

Deliver various cyber threat intelligence reports – e.g. threat landscape, scenario libraries, changes to mitigation and exploitation assumptions, etc. – on a quarterly cadence

The Skills and Experience You Will Bring

Bachelor's or master's degree in cyber security, computer science, statistics, economics, mathematics, or related field

3-5 years experience in offensive and/or defensive cyber security (CISSP, CEH, CISM, CompTIA Security+, or other certification preferred)

Working fluency in Python / R, SQL, flat files and complex data types (JSON, XML), APIs, and Excel – enough to specify and interpret analysis with Data/Analytics teams

Ability to translate real-world cyber threat behavior into modeling assumptions and scenarios – e.g. scenario likelihoods, severity, and mitigation impacts

Intellectual curiosity, willingness to learn new skills, and push ideas forward

Strong critical thinking and problem-solving skills

Strong communication and consulting presence with key stakeholders

Experience working in and leading project teams

Ability to work in an agile, fast-paced startup environment

Ability to maintain relationships, collaborate effectively, and meet deadlines with a distributed, remote-first workforce

Ability to think creatively and respond to emerging threats (cyber, AI, other) and their modeling implications in a timely manner

The Extra Credit, or The Focus Areas You Will Develop

Experience with analytics and risk modeling

Experience in a SaaS product development environment

Familiarity with ML techniques and statistical data analysis

Familiarity with AI / LLM risk and its implications for cyber risk, social engineering, product safety, errors/omissions, and critical infrastructure

Familiarity with a wide variety of Internet technologies such as BGP, TCP/IP, DNS, etc.
